Seniors

The Center is located at 103 East Main Street, West Newton, PA and can be reached at 724 - 872 - 4976. Hours are Monday – Friday, 8 a.m.  - 3:30 p.m.

The Center offers many daily and weekly activities: cards, puzzles, Wii bowling, ping pong, trivia, crafts, pool, nutrition and socialization. Lunch is at noon every day. Food is ordered a week ahead of time so please make your reservation by Tuesday. There is also Bible study, bingo, exercise and cards.

Monthly bus trips are always offered – Stop by the Center and get all the details. Sign up early, the buses fill fast!
